Transaction 0c62828eea74e987cf703ff46b3db7d579b3346144949ae40fd2fcb8c1a84b77

1 Input
2 Outputs
  • 0c62828eea74e987cf703ff46b3db7d579b3346144949ae40fd2fcb8c1a84b77:0
  • value  95677945
    address  1HayTCw9ZFk3q4W52UWMNVdvYDtxTUMgDC
  • 0c62828eea74e987cf703ff46b3db7d579b3346144949ae40fd2fcb8c1a84b77:1
  • value  580000
    address  3CKjTsaAEpPc8wyzGKbhueRFQg7NFxg4Ep